Craig Jones To Face Ronaldo Junior In Main Event Of Next “Who’s Number One”


The next installment of FloGrappling’s Who’s Number One is coming back to Austin, Texas at the end of February, and Flo has just released the main event in their lineup of superfights for the event.

ADCC silver medalist Craig Jones will be taking on 2020 Pans champion Ronaldo Junior in a 195-lb no-gi catchweight match. The bout will take place under WNO rules and have a duration of fifteen minutes, as will the other matches on the card.

Jones, a two-division Polaris champion, is now an established submission grappling superstar. He managed to have a fairly busy 2020, competing in eight Submission Underground events and getting a heel hook win over Roberto Jimenez at WNO 4.

Even against an opponent like Jones, though, Junior shouldn’t be underestimated. His own WNO appearance saw him lose a referee decision against the dominant Vagner Rocha, but he’s since been busy making his way to the top of the podium at big events like Pans, No-Gi Pans, and American Nationals.

This main event is a big match that will help get the momentum started for another exciting grappling event that we can look forward to this year.

WNO will take place on Friday, February 26 and can be streamed live on FloGrappling.
